MITIE Conference, plus New Cloudwork Features

Once again we attended the MITIE Conference this time in Canberra and can report that it was our most successful conference to date. We received keen interest from both schools and Service Providers regarding our Cloudwork Identity Provider service and how they can benefit.

As well we received clear messages on required new features and how we can improve Cloudwork. We highly value that feedback and use it for our product planning - remember every feature that you see in the Cloudwork of today has come from suggestions made by the school user community over the past 6 years of product development. The 3 clear requests that were clearly identified for us are:

* Password Reset - schools want their users to be able to securely reset their own passwords without any intervention from the school service desk
* AD account provisioning - auto provisioning and maintenance of accounts in AD based on information coming from a variety of sources including the school's management system
* Improved documentation and administration facilities - the Cloudwork administration interface is 6 years old and needs to be modernised to provide better control and reporting options for school administrators

Studentnet is glad to report that we are making progress on each of these 3 requirements, as below.

Improved administration system

Studentnet has commenced coding of V2 of our new administration system to replace the current V1 facility. The current administration system was introduced when Studentnet announced that we were taking school's to the cloud in 2007 - well ahead of today's popular movement. Our V1 administration facility has worked well for us since being introduced in 2008 but it is now showing its age and now needs to be upgraded with a new look and even more functionality.

In particular the V2 administration interface will include:
* Greater exposure of your existing configuration
* Better logging of user activity
* Better reporting
* More documentation especially with improved implementation of both initial setup and new service providers
* More modern look and feel
